一種面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)組織方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及能源計量技術(shù)領(lǐng)域的用于工業(yè)企業(yè)能源計量系統(tǒng)的數(shù)據(jù)查詢的方法, 特別涉及一種面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)組織方法。
【背景技術(shù)】
[0002] 隨著社會的進(jìn)步以及國家節(jié)能減排政策的不斷深入,工業(yè)企業(yè)節(jié)能減排壓力與日 倶增,企業(yè)對能源消耗的監(jiān)測及控制的要求也越來越高。為達(dá)到國家節(jié)能標(biāo)準(zhǔn),各企業(yè)采取 多種手段提高能源利用率。每個企業(yè)都把能源計量工作作為企業(yè)成本核算的基礎(chǔ),也是企 業(yè)實(shí)現(xiàn)節(jié)能降耗的關(guān)鍵。如何在能源緊張的情況下,使企業(yè)加強(qiáng)能源計量管理,減少能源浪 費(fèi),是一項重要工作。建立能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)集能夠有效地對工業(yè)企業(yè)的能源 使用情況等重要指標(biāo)數(shù)據(jù)進(jìn)行統(tǒng)計、分析、對比,從而幫助管理者制定計劃,做出決策。企業(yè) 生產(chǎn)規(guī)模與業(yè)務(wù)規(guī)模的不斷擴(kuò)大,使能源計量數(shù)據(jù)不斷增長,能源計量管理也日益復(fù)雜。如 何對大量的能源計量數(shù)據(jù)進(jìn)行統(tǒng)一、高效、方便的管理,已成為能源計量管理的重要難點(diǎn)。 現(xiàn)有的一些能源計量數(shù)據(jù)查詢方法,主要存在以下問題:
[0003] (1)目前的一些能源計量系統(tǒng)的能源計量采集數(shù)據(jù)不能存儲在統(tǒng)一的商用庫存儲 表中,一般是根據(jù)不同的能源介質(zhì)進(jìn)行分類存儲,增加了商用庫的存儲表數(shù)量,由于能源 計量數(shù)據(jù)存儲在不同的存儲表中,數(shù)據(jù)集訪問需要不同的訪問接口,這也增加了數(shù)據(jù)訪問 接口的復(fù)雜度。數(shù)據(jù)訪問接口復(fù)雜不利于能源計量數(shù)據(jù)查詢的擴(kuò)展和數(shù)據(jù)的快速訪問。
[0004] (2)目前的一些能源計量系統(tǒng)數(shù)據(jù)查詢單一,有的系統(tǒng)只能進(jìn)行單表的表碼查詢, 有的系統(tǒng)由于沒有采用數(shù)據(jù)集管理的方法,在進(jìn)行多表查詢和明細(xì)查詢時,系統(tǒng)響應(yīng)時間 長,影響用戶使用效果。
[0005] 本案涉及的名詞定義如下:
[0006] 數(shù)據(jù)集:查詢數(shù)據(jù)結(jié)果按一定的規(guī)則組織起來的數(shù)據(jù)集合,是能源計量系統(tǒng)進(jìn)行 數(shù)據(jù)展示的數(shù)據(jù)源。
[0007] 0ID:數(shù)據(jù)存儲的區(qū)分標(biāo)志位,在能源計量系統(tǒng)中唯一存在,是數(shù)據(jù)查詢結(jié)果準(zhǔn)確 的保證。
【發(fā)明內(nèi)容】
[0008] 本發(fā)明的目的,在于提供一種面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)組織方 法,本一種面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)組織方法使企業(yè)各級管理人員能從 多角度、高效、靈活地對企業(yè)能源計量數(shù)據(jù)進(jìn)行管理分析。
[0009] 為了達(dá)成上述目的,本發(fā)明的解決方案是:一種面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ù) 查詢的數(shù)據(jù)組織方法,包括以下步驟:
[0010] ⑴對企業(yè)內(nèi)的水、電、氣、熱等能源介質(zhì)的采集數(shù)據(jù)進(jìn)行詳細(xì)分類,以能源介質(zhì)類 型為區(qū)分標(biāo)志,將所有的能源計量數(shù)據(jù)統(tǒng)一存儲在商用庫中;
[0011] (2)根據(jù)不同能源介質(zhì)數(shù)據(jù)特點(diǎn)建立相應(yīng)的數(shù)據(jù)集結(jié)構(gòu),該數(shù)據(jù)集結(jié)構(gòu)是查詢數(shù) 據(jù)結(jié)果的結(jié)構(gòu);
[0012] (3)建立統(tǒng)一的數(shù)據(jù)查詢接口,根據(jù)查詢條件(時間、介質(zhì)類別)從商用庫獲取相 應(yīng)的數(shù)據(jù);
[0013] (4)以建立的數(shù)據(jù)結(jié)構(gòu)為模板,把獲取的數(shù)據(jù)以時間為順序,組織成數(shù)據(jù)集。
[0014] 上述步驟(1)中,對企業(yè)內(nèi)的水、電、氣、熱等能源介質(zhì)的采集數(shù)據(jù)進(jìn)行詳細(xì)分類, 建立能源介質(zhì)類型,每種能源介質(zhì)以介質(zhì)類型為區(qū)分標(biāo)志,統(tǒng)一存儲在通用的商用庫存儲 表中,減少商用庫重復(fù)建表。
[0015] 上述步驟⑵中,以不同能源介質(zhì)查詢結(jié)果內(nèi)容的不同,建立相應(yīng)的數(shù)據(jù)集結(jié)構(gòu)。 該數(shù)據(jù)集結(jié)構(gòu)要和查詢結(jié)果相對應(yīng)。
[0016] 上述步驟(3)中,建立統(tǒng)一的數(shù)據(jù)查詢接口,該查詢接口以能源介質(zhì)類型為區(qū)分, 適應(yīng)水、電、氣、熱等不同能源介質(zhì)數(shù)據(jù)查詢的不同要求。
[0017] 上述步驟(4)的具體內(nèi)容是:以建立的數(shù)據(jù)結(jié)構(gòu)為模板,把獲取的數(shù)據(jù)以時間為 順序,組織成有序的數(shù)據(jù)集。并把數(shù)據(jù)集反饋至web前端進(jìn)行展示。
[0018] 采用上述方案后,本發(fā)明具有以下優(yōu)點(diǎn):
[0019] (1)對企業(yè)內(nèi)的水、電、氣、熱等能源介質(zhì)的采集數(shù)據(jù)統(tǒng)一存儲管理,以能源介質(zhì)類 型為區(qū)分標(biāo)志。減少了商用庫中存儲表的數(shù)量,方便維護(hù),同時易于擴(kuò)展,通過增加新的能 源介質(zhì)類型可以直接存儲在原來的商用庫存儲表中,整個過程中無需開發(fā)支持,快速而高 效;
[0020] (2)統(tǒng)一的能源計量數(shù)據(jù)查詢訪問接口,適應(yīng)水、電、氣、熱等不同能源介質(zhì)的數(shù)據(jù) 庫訪問需求,減少了編碼數(shù)量,同時新增能源計量介質(zhì)類型時,擴(kuò)展方便,減少了數(shù)據(jù)訪問 的復(fù)雜度;
[0021] (3)根據(jù)能源計量數(shù)據(jù)的查詢內(nèi)容確定數(shù)據(jù)集的結(jié)構(gòu),把數(shù)據(jù)形象直觀的展示給 管理人員。提高了能源計量管理系統(tǒng)的適用性和高效性。
【附圖說明】
[0022] 圖1是本發(fā)明中能源計量數(shù)據(jù)存儲結(jié)構(gòu)示意圖;
[0023] 圖2是本發(fā)明中能源計量數(shù)據(jù)集結(jié)構(gòu)示意圖;
[0024] 圖3是本發(fā)明中能源計量數(shù)據(jù)統(tǒng)一訪問流程示意圖;
[0025] 圖4是本發(fā)明中能源計量數(shù)據(jù)集組織流程示意圖。
【具體實(shí)施方式】
[0026] 下面將結(jié)合附圖,對本發(fā)明的技術(shù)方案進(jìn)行詳細(xì)說明。
[0027] 參見圖1-圖4,本面向工業(yè)企業(yè)能源計量系統(tǒng)數(shù)據(jù)查詢的數(shù)據(jù)組織方法,其過程 包括:能源計量采集數(shù)據(jù)的分類統(tǒng)一存儲、建立與查詢內(nèi)容相對應(yīng)的數(shù)據(jù)集結(jié)構(gòu)、編寫統(tǒng)一 的商用數(shù)據(jù)庫數(shù)據(jù)訪問接口和獲取數(shù)據(jù)并以數(shù)據(jù)集結(jié)構(gòu)為模板組織數(shù)據(jù)集四部分。
[0028] -、能源計量采集數(shù)據(jù)的分類統(tǒng)一存儲
[0029] 系統(tǒng)接入的能源計量數(shù)據(jù)按照屬性分為兩類:一類是累計量的表碼值如:正向有 功電度、正向無功電度等,該類數(shù)據(jù)主要用于能源用量的統(tǒng)計;一類是瞬時量如:電壓、電 流、溫度、壓力等,該類數(shù)據(jù)不進(jìn)行統(tǒng)計,只供查詢。系統(tǒng)將兩類數(shù)據(jù)分別存儲在以DC0UNT_ HIS_和TANALOGINPUT_開頭的兩類商用庫表中,每類商用庫存儲表以月份為后綴對數(shù)據(jù)進(jìn) 行存儲。
[0030] 系統(tǒng)提供了統(tǒng)一的數(shù)據(jù)存儲接口,用以將各采集終端數(shù)據(jù)源的數(shù)據(jù)存儲到商用 庫,并建立全局統(tǒng)一的計量對象及索引。原始的能源計量數(shù)據(jù)在商用庫的存儲表中建立全 局統(tǒng)一計量對象。
[0031] 累計量的存儲表DC0UNT_HIS_中每個存儲點(diǎn)包含表1所示的字段:
[0032] 表 1